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
507 077673047 19766755 011146962 16481529611
2955075 4637 85122211
2955075 4637 85122211
58964 60583797250 823 6366
All about undefined
Interested in learning more?
2955075 4637 85122211
58964 60583797250 823 6366
See more
5099 94527 8939
279398030 54 58213902
See more
587781 720
612633 290 63869032504 562396984
See more